Types of fluorescent lighting replacement

When considering an fluorescent lighting replacement, it is important to understand the different types available in the market. Each type has its own specifications, features, and applications. Here are some of the most common types:

  • LED Tubes

    These tubes are specifically designed to replace traditional fluorescent tubes. They are available in different sizes like T8 tubes. The T8 LED tubes come in 4 feet long and are the most commonly used, while T12LED tubes are 38mm in diameter. They are also used in applications where energy efficiency is prioritized. The T5 LED tubes are smaller, with a diameter of 16mm, and are commonly used in modern lighting fixtures. These tubes offer different lighting configurations, such as cool white or natural white, to ensure optimal brightness and energy efficiency.

  • Compact Fluorescent Lamps (CFLs)

    These lamps are commonly used to replace traditional incandescent bulbs. They are designed with a spiral or curly shape that fits into a standard screw or bayonet fitting. These bulbs are energy efficient and consume up to 75% less energy than incandescent bulbs. They have a long lifespan and can last up to 10,000 hours. Also, they provide a range of color temperatures such as warm, cool, and neutral. Some models are designed with dimming capabilities.

  • LED Panel Lights

    These are modern lighting fixtures designed to replace fluorescent ceiling panels. They are ideal for use in offices, commercial spaces, and homes. The panels come in different sizes that fit standard drop ceiling grids. They offer uniform light distribution with minimal glare and are energy efficient. They consume less power than traditional fluorescent panels. They have a long operational lifespan of up to 50,000 hours. Also, they provide different color temperatures ranging from warm to cool.

  • Smart LED Bulbs

    These bulbs are designed to replace traditional incandescent or CFL bulbs. They offer advanced features for automation and remote control. The bulbs are designed to fit into standard sockets. They are compatible with most lighting fixtures. Also, they are energy efficient and consume less power than traditional incandescent bulbs. They have a long lifespan that can range from 15,000 to 50,000 hours. Additionally, they come with different color temperatures and can produce a wide range of colors.

Features and Functions of Fluorescent Lighting Replacement

Fluorescent light bulbs are being replaced by LED bulbs. The features and functions of this replacement are as follows:

  • Fluorescent lights are replaced with LED tubes for better energy efficiency. The replaced tubes use less energy than the traditional ones, which saves money on electricity bills.
  • The replacement LED tubes last longer than the traditional tube lights. The average lifespan of an LED tube light is about 50,000 hours. This means the tubes can be used for several years before they burn out. The long lifespan reduces maintenance costs and the need to replace the tubes often.
  • The replaced LED tubes emit light more efficiently than the traditional tubes. They have a higher lumen output. The tube lights come in different sizes and diameters, which produce different lumens. For instance, a T8 LED tube light produces about 2200 lumens. A T12 tube light produces 600 lumens, while a T10 light produces between 900 and 1800 lumens. The efficient light output means the lights can be used in different spaces depending on the amount of light required.
  • The replacement LED tubes are compatible with most fluorescent ballasts. This means the LEDs can be easily integrated into existing lighting systems without changing the entire setup. They also come with different installation methods, such as direct wiring and bypassing the ballast or using a ballast compatible with the LED tube.
  • Safety and environmental concerns are part of the replacement process. The replaced fluorescent lights contain mercury, which is a dangerous chemical. The replaced LED lights are safer because they do not have mercury. They also have a higher CRI (Color Rendering Index) than traditional fluorescent lights. The CRI refers to how the light makes objects appear. LED lights make objects appear more natural and colorful.
  • The replaced LED tubes have a variety of color temperatures and are dimmable. Color temperature refers to how warm or cool the light appears. The LED tubes have color temperatures ranging from 2700K to 6500K. The lower range of 2700K means the light is warm and good for areas where relaxation is done, such as living rooms. The higher range of 6500K means the light is cool and used in office spaces. Dimmable LED tubes allow users to adjust the brightness level according to their needs. This helps to save energy because less light is used when the brightness is lowered.

How to choose fluorescent lighting replacement

When‌ considering fluorescent lighting replacements, various factors should be considered to ensure an ideal match for the intended space. These are some key elements to consider when choosing a replacement for fluorescent lights.

  • Light Output

    When selecting a replacement, it is important to examine the lumen output. The amount of light emitted by a bulb is called lumen. A higher lumen count means a brighter bulb. A bulb with a lower lumen count will produce less light than the previous bulb, while one with a higher lumen count will produce more light.

  • Color Temperature

    The color temperature of a light source indicates how warm or cool the light appears. It is measured in Kelvin (K). A lower color temperature (around 2700K) appears warmer, while a higher one (around 5000K) appears cooler. The choice depends largely on personal preferences, but it also depends on the intended use and the atmosphere that needs to be created.

  • Energy Efficiency

    When replacing fluorescent lights, it is advisable to consider energy efficiency. This is usually indicated by the number of watts the light uses. Generally, LED lights use fewer watts than traditional fluorescent bulbs. Therefore, replacing an existing bulb with an LED bulb with a lower wattage is a good idea.

  • Compatibility

    It is important to consider whether the replacement bulb is compatible with the current fixture. Some may require specific ballasts to function properly, while others are ballast bypass. The existing setup should be evaluated to ensure the ideal replacement is chosen.

  • Dimming Capability

    Some lighting systems require the use of dimmers to adjust the level of brightness. In such cases, it is necessary to choose a replacement bulb that is compatible with the dimming switch. Not all bulbs are compatible with dimming switches, and those that are not will usually operate at full brightness.

  • Life Span

    Fluorescent lights have a shorter lifespan than LEDs. When choosing a replacement, it is important to consider the lifespan of the existing fixture. This is important because LED lights have a longer lifespan, and knowing this will help to determine when the replacement will be due.

Fluorescent lighting replacement Q&A

Q1: What are the benefits of LED over traditional light sources?

A1: LEDs have many benefits over traditional light sources, including longer lifespans, higher efficiency, better directional lighting, and improved dimming capabilities. Additionally, LEDs emit less heat and, depending on the color, may be better for human health than traditional lights.

Q2: What should one consider when buying an LED tube light?

A2: When buying an LED tube light, pay attention to the lumen output, color temperature, CRI, and energy efficiency. Additionally, consider the light's compatibility with existing fixtures, its lifespan, and any specific features such as dimming capability or smart technology.

Q3: What does LED stand for?

A3: LED means light emitting diode. Diodes are electrical devices that conduct current in one direction only. In this case, the diode emits light when electrical current passes through it.

Q4: What does CRI mean?

A4: CRI means color rendering index. It is a measure of a light source's ability to reproduce colors accurately. The index is on a scale of 1 to 100, and the higher the number, the more the light source renders colors accurately.

Q5: What is the lifespan of LED lights?

A5: The average lifespan of LED lights is about 50,000 hours. This means they can last up to 25 times longer than traditional incandescent bulbs. They also last 3 to 5 times longer than halogen and fluorescent lights.
